I’ve always been drawn to stories of second chances. Not the glossy, fairytale kind—but the ones that come after life has cracked you open.
The kind of love that doesn’t rescue you…
but meets you where you are.
Set against the lush, sensory backdrop of Panama, this novel is steeped in color, texture, and feeling—coffee plantations at dawn, tropical rainstorms that arrive with thunder and leave the world rinsed clean, emerald greens that seem to hold memory and promise all at once.
This is a love story for women (and men) who have lived.
Who know that true love isn’t about possession or safety alone—but about truth, respect, and choice.
